This guide outlines critical issues that general counsel need to be aware of concerning ransomware, a growing multibillion-dollar criminal industry. It discusses the significant impact of ransomware attacks on business operations, emphasizing that paying a ransom does not guarantee recovery and often leads to extended downtime. The guide stresses the importance of robust incident response plans, including the incorporation of ransomware playbooks and tabletop exercises. It also highlights the complexities surrounding cyber-insurance coverage, noting the increased scrutiny from insurers due to the rising frequency of attacks. The document details the evolving tactics of ransomware actors, including double extortion methods, and the legal implications of ransom payments in light of regulatory guidance from U.S. authorities. Furthermore, it addresses the shifting approach of U.S. law enforcement in combating ransomware, including the establishment of a dedicated task force aimed at enhancing coordination and information sharing among agencies and the private sector.
